One police officer has died while three others have been injured after the vehicle they were traveling in rolled while they were on their way to Balambala to provide security in the repeat presidential election.

Confirming the incident, Garissa OCPD Aron Moriase said the officers were escorting presidential election materials from Garissa Town when the vehicle rolled at Abdisamit.

According to the police, the driver lost control of the vehicle before it rolled several times killing one officer on the spot and injuring others.

The Garissa police boss said the injured officers were taken to Garissa Referral Hospital.

The repeat presidential election is expected to kick off countrywide at 6am Thursday with hundreds of police officers sent to provide security.
